Book Description

May 28, 2008
A century of cartoon delights under one cover!

Another great Arf book for 2008, and it features one of the greatest comickers of all: Milt Gross! The Gross-ness starts off with a stunning cover painting done in the 1930s but, as they say, ripped from today's headlines. It's all about immigration: Uncle Sam grinds up a sea of immigrants and out come...classic comic strip characters!

Milt Gross drew a 1920s comic that left the last panel blank for aspiring cartoonists. Editor Craig Yoe drafted a who's who of contemporary cartoonists to complete Gross's unfinished masterpieces. Art Spiegelman, Matt Groening, Seymour Chwast, Patrick McDonnell, Mort Walker, R. Crumb, Bil Keane, Johnny Ryan, Jaime Hernandez, Mike Mignola, Bill Griffith, Kaz, Gene Deitch, Joost Swarte and a dozen more cartooning celebrities contribute art especially done for this Arf Happening!

The Arf books are famed for unearthing unknown Old Skool cartoonist geniuses. Comic Arf showcases the brilliant Dudley Fisher who amazingly drew crowded scenes all from a bird's eye view. Arch Dale is another unsung genius getting his due with his Smurfs-meet-Dr. Seuss characters, the Doo-Dads, who populated Canadian comic strips 75 years ago.

Arf also highlights unusual work from recognized masters. Walt Kelly, famed for his Pogo strip, did a surreal nightmarish strip for children presented in all its glory in this latest Arf tome. All this and much more, from 1950s devilish horror comics to cartoonist portraits by Gary Panter and Mitch O'Connell.

Editorial Reviews

From Booklist

The fourth volume in Yoe’s Arf series dedicated to “the unholy marriage of art and comics” is the strongest yet, due in no small part to a major chunk of it being devoted to vintage work by screwball cartoonist Milt Gross. First up is a generous sampling of Gross’ 1920s Draw Your Own Conclusions, in which Gross drew a three-panel setup and left the ending for readers to fill in. His 31 collaborators here include many top contemporary comics artists, from mainstream mainstays Mort Walker and Bil Keane to undergrounders R. Crumb and Art Spiegelman. An assortment of Gross’ other strips follows. More rediscovered treasures on hand include a pre-Pogo Walt Kelly story, Dudley Fisher’s remarkable bird’s-eye-view Sunday newspaper pages, Gardner Rea’s sophisticated magazine cartoons, Argentine girlie cartoonist Guillermo Divito, and another of the hell-themed pieces Yoe fancies, this one by underrated comic-book master Bob Powell and reproduced, like many of the other selections, from the original art. Yoe’s access to such riches appears limitless, so bark and howl for more, comics fans. --Gordon Flagg

About the Author

Craig Yoe operates Yoe! Studio from a mountaintop castle overlooking the Hudson River with his partner, Clizia Gussoni. YOE! creates anything from toys to theme parks, animation to advertising, for clients ranging from MTV to Nickelodeon, Microsoft to MAD.

More About the Author

Vice magazine calls Craig Yoe the "Indiana Jones of comics historians." Publishers Weekly says he's the "archivist of the ridiculous and sublime" and calls his work "brilliant." The Onion calls him "the celebrated designer." The Library Journal, "a comics guru." BoingBoing hails him "a fine cartoonist and a comic book historian of the first water." Yoe was Creative Director/Vice President/General Manager of Jim Henson's Muppets, and a Creative Director at Nickelodeon and Disney. Craig has won an Eisner Award and the Gold Medal from the Society of Illustrators.
